Influence of tumor necrosis factor on the growth of vegetative and nonculturable forms of Salmonella
Romanova IuM,Alekseeva Nv,Stepanova Tv,Razumikhin Mv,Shilov Ia,Tomova As,Alexander L. Gintsburg +6 more
TL;DR: The multiplication rate, in vivo and in vitro, of Salmonella vegetative and uncultivable forms with mutation in gene pqi did not change after the incubation of the cells with cytokine, indicative of an important role played by the product of this gene in the process of the interaction of bacteria with cytokines.

Mechanism of interaction of tumor necrosis factor (TNF-a) of macroorganism with Salmonella Enterica cells (Ser. Typhimurium)
Yu. M. Romanova,Tomova As,L. N. Shingarova,Vladimir G. Lunin,Anna S. Karyagina,I. P. Lupu,Alexander L. Gintsburg +6 more
TL;DR: The specificity of the bacteria-cytokine interaction was demonstrated and bacterial protein EF-Tu, which mediates the direct interaction of bacteria with cytokine, was identified using the method of immobilization of the recombinant protein TNF-α-spacer-CBD on cellulose.
